如何在单行C#winforms文本框中指出有更多文本?

有时,带有C#Visual Studio 2010的winforms中的固定宽度单行文本框包含正确的字符宽度,两个字符(或单词)之间的边界与文本框的边缘对齐,因此无法分辨没有用鼠标单击和拖动的更多文本.

指示有更多文字的最佳做法是什么?

解决方法:

要么根本不使用单行文本框

或者像我一样..创建了一个继承TextBox类的自定义文本框控件,使其看起来像Shekha …当它溢出并且没有聚焦时,当它有焦点时将Text设置回Shekhar_Pro或者它原来的任何东西.

上一篇:javascript – 焦点更改时保持文本选择


下一篇:javascript – 如何在用户点击它时消失的文本字段中显示灰色文本